Step-by-Step Instructions
Boil the Pasta
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Add spaghetti and cook until al dente. Drain and set aside.
Sear the Beef
Coat the diced beef evenly with Cajun seasoning. Heat butter in a skillet over medium-high heat, add beef, and sear until browned.
Create the Creamy Sauce
In the same skillet, sauté minced garlic, then pour in heavy cream. Add cream cheese, mozzarella, and Parmesan, stirring until melted and smooth.
Combine Everything
Add the cooked spaghetti and beef back into the skillet, tossing well to coat every strand with the creamy sauce.
Serve and Enjoy
Sprinkle with fresh parsley and an optional pinch of Cajun seasoning. Serve warm and enjoy the creamy goodness!

How to Store Cajun Beef Spaghetti with Creamy Three-Cheese Parmesan Sauce
Refrigerator
Store leftovers in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
Freezer
Freeze in individual portions for up to 2 months. Thaw before reheating.
Reheating
Reheat on the stovetop over low heat, adding a splash of milk or cream if the sauce thickens.
